ホームページ >ウェブフロントエンド >jsチュートリアル >Node.js+koa はシンプルなバックエンド管理システムを構築します

Node.js+koa はシンプルなバックエンド管理システムを構築します

青灯夜游
青灯夜游転載
2021-02-07 18:33:362853ブラウズ

Node.js+koa はシンプルなバックエンド管理システムを構築します

関連する推奨事項: 「nodejs チュートリアル

node.js を使用してバックグラウンド管理システムを実装します。 Node.js で一般的に使用されるフレームワークは、express と koa です。このプロジェクトでは koa を使用します。

ステップ

ステップ 1: node.js をグローバルにインストールする

ステップ 2: プロジェクト ディレクトリをローカルに作成します。

ステップ 3: ローカル依存関係のインストール: npm i koa koa-views koa-static koa-router koa-body pug -S

ステップ 4: プロジェクトのアクティブ化: nodemon app.js
Node.js+koa はシンプルなバックエンド管理システムを構築します
Node.js+koa はシンプルなバックエンド管理システムを構築します
Node.js+koa はシンプルなバックエンド管理システムを構築します

#プロジェクトで実装した機能:

ニュース一覧の表示

    ページング機能
  • 単一の表示ページをクリックして詳細ページに移動します
  • ニュースのアップロード
注意事項:

    レイヤーの使用状況を表示するpug テンプレートなので、html を pug 形式に変換し、メソッドをキャプチャして交換する必要があります https://html2jade.org/
  • pug テンプレートでは、「|」はエスケープを意味します
  • asynchronous 、ここでは aysnc await を使用する必要があります。
  • ソース コード
  • ## を使用してアップロードされたフォーム
  • #node.js の enctype に注意してください。 #https://github.com/sunshine5856/newList/tree/hqq
プログラミング関連の知識については、

プログラミング教育

をご覧ください。 !

以上がNode.js+koa はシンプルなバックエンド管理システムを構築しますの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事はcsdn.netで複製されています。侵害がある場合は、admin@php.cn までご連絡ください。